February 07, 1970: Number 1 song on that day

The number 1 song on February 07, 1970 is the best selling or most popular song as resulting from the music charts in the week February 2nd and February 8th. It changes depending on Countries, Music Genres and methodology used to rank the most popular song (for ex., sales, streaming).


February 07, 1970: What was the number 1 song in the USA on that day?

The number 1 song in the USA on February 07, 1970 was Venus by The Shocking Blue, according to the music chart for the week February 2nd and February 8th.

February 07, 1970: What was the music chart in the USA on that day?

The music chart in the USA on February 07, 1970 is the list of the most popular songs across all genres for the week February 2nd and February 8th. It included the following Top 5 songs:

  1. - Venus
  2. - I Want You Back
  3. - Raindrops Keep Fallin' On My Head
  4. - Thank You (Falettinme Be Mice Elf Agin)
  5. - Without Love (There Is Nothing)

February 07, 1970: What was the number 1 song in the UK on that day?

The number 1 song in the UK on February 07, 1970 was Love Grows (Where My Rosemary Grows) by Edison Lighthouse, according to the music chart for the week February 2nd and February 8th.

February 07, 1970: What was the music chart in the UK on that day?

The music chart in the UK on February 07, 1970 is the list of the most popular songs across all genres for the week February 2nd and February 8th. It included the following Top 5 songs:

  1. - Love Grows (Where My Rosemary Grows)
  2. - Let's Work Together
  3. - Leavin' On A Jet Plane
  4. - I Want You Back
  5. - Wand'rin' Star

Who was the US President on February 07, 1970?

On February 07, 1970 the US President was Richard Nixon (Republican).

Who was the UK Prime Minister on February 07, 1970?

On February 07, 1970 the UK Prime Minister was Harold Wilson (Labour).

Who was the Pope on February 07, 1970?

On February 07, 1970 the Pope was St Paul VI.
